    Manual – 3000 NRL Family Neon Remote Loggers There are many different models of Neon Remote Loggers available. While the models may be different, and the interfaces available in various models are different, the basic operation of all Neon Remote Loggers is the same.     Manual – 3000 NRL Family NRL Internal Architecture The NRL Internal architecture is shown below. It contains two discrete sections: 1. A LOGGER section where the terminal connects to the field transducers and the logging scheme, scan rates and diagnostics are managed. The StarlogV4 support software allows a user to generate a logger program (called a scheme) which defines transducer information, logging scan rates, logger interval etc and various engineering unit definitions.

    Manual – 3000 NRL Family Firmware Update Indication While the logger is transferring firmware update data from either Neon, or an MMC/SD card, the logger will continue to operate as normal until the firmware data has been fully downloaded and verified. Once verified, the firmware data will be flashed, which may take up to 20 seconds.

    Manual – 3000 NRL Family 3004B-MC Neon Remote Logger Cellular The 3004MC Neon Remote Logger Cellular is a Neon Remote Logger in the 3004M range which has a smaller form factor than the standard metal enclosure 3004. It is housed in a polycarbonate case. It utilises the Cellular phone networks as its method of sending sensor data from the field to the Neon Server.
